who was in the triple alliance

The Triple Alliance in Europe before World War I was made up of Germany , Austria-Hungary , and Italy.

Quick Scoop

  • The Triple Alliance was a military and political pact formed in 1882.
  • Its three members were:
    • Germany
    • Austria-Hungary
    • Italy
  • The agreement said they would support each other if one was attacked, especially by France.
  • It was renewed several times and lasted until 1915, when Italy left and later fought against its former allies in World War I.

Little historical twist

At the start of World War I in 1914, Germany and Austria-Hungary fought together, but Italy stayed neutral at first and then joined the opposing side, the Triple Entente, in 1915.
